检测 Telegram 的应用内浏览器

问题描述 投票:0回答:1

我们如何检测(使用客户端 JS 或服务器 PHP 语言)应用内浏览器请求显示我们的页面?

我在 stackoverflow 中看到了这个 QA,但我想在 Telegram Messenger 中这样做。 我在 Telegram 应用内浏览器和 Chrome 浏览器中看到 useragentstring.com。两者显示完全相同的结果:

Mozilla/5.0 (Linux; Android 6.0.1; ASUS_Z00LD Build/MMB29P)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/51.0.2704.81 Mobile Safari/537.36

有什么建议可以解决这个问题吗?

javascript php inappbrowser telegram
1个回答
0
投票
if (typeof window.TelegramWebview !== 'undefined') {
    console.log('Found Telegram Webview');
}

8yo 问题但出现在 Google 上。 感谢 github 上的 mujeebcpy。

© www.soinside.com 2019 - 2024. All rights reserved.